Michael Dale Korester, 26, of Padroni, died Thursday, June 26, 2003, near Padroni. Visitation will be Monday, June 30, from 10 a.m. to 7 p.m. at Chaney-Reager Funeral Home. Funeral services will be Tuesday, July 1, at 11 a.m. at Peetz Community. United Methodist Church, with Rev. Beverly Webb officiating. Burial will follow at Peetz Cemetery. Mr. Koester was born Sept. 10, 1976, in Sterling to Vern Koester and Barbara (Quirey)Koester.
He was a life-long resident of the Peetz and Padroni areas, and graduated from Peetz High School in 1995. He then attend ed Northeastern Junior College for three years.
Mike had a strong passion for sports, and played all sports
in high scho lettering in basketball, baseball and football. He was active as a referee in basketball and served as an umpire in baseball.
He was engaged in farming with his family, and also worked at Culligan Water Conditioning Co.
Mr. Koester was a member of Peetz Community United Methodist Church, and Sterling Elks Lodge No. 1336.
He is survived by parents Vern "Slim" and Barbara Koester, of Padroni; brother Tom Koester and wife Diane, of Sterling; sisters Deb Sargent and husband Bob, of Scottsbluff, Neb., Kathy Glassburn and husband Del, of Sterling, Terry Carwin and hus band Randy, of Proctor, Karen Koester, of Padroni; grand mother Ethel Klee, of Sterling; and 11 nieces and nephews.
Memorials may be made to Peetz Community United Methodist Church or Peetz High School athletic department.
